Unity Bancorp Reports Quarterly Earnings of $9.7 Million

CLINTON, N.J., July 14,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Unity Bancorp, Inc. (NASDAQ: UNTY), parent company of Unity Bank, reported net income of $9.7 million, or $0.95 per diluted share, for the quarter ended June 30, 2023, compared to net income of $10.3 million, or $0.96 per diluted share for the quarter ended March 31, 2023. This represents a 5.7% decrease in net income and a 1.0% decrease in net income per diluted share. For the six months ended June 30, 2023, Unity reported net income of $20.0 million or $1.91 per diluted share, compared to net income of $18.6 million or $1.74 per diluted share for the six months ended June 30, 2022. This represents a 7.7% increase in net income and a 9.8% increase in net income per diluted share. James A. Hexagon Purus receives order from a large European OEM to deliver mobile 700 bar hydrogen refueling station

(Oslo, 14 July 2023) Hexagon Purus, a world leading manufacturer of zero emission mobility and infrastructure solutions, has received an order from a large European OEM to develop and deliver the next generation mobile hydrogen refueling station for 700 bar commercial vehicles. The OEM intends to integrate the Hexagon Purus’ mobile hydrogen refueling station to demonstrate and verify hydrogen energy supply to commercial vehicles. The value of the order is approximately EUR 3 million. Nilorn Interim Report Q2, 2023

Period April – JuneOrder bookings decreased by 32 percent to MSEK 167 (245). Net revenue decreased by 14 percent to MSEK 230 (269). Net revenue adjusted for currency effects amounted to MSEK 220, i.e. an underlying organic decrease of 18 percent. Operating profit amounted to MSEK 16.1 (44.9). Profit before taxes amounted to MSEK 12.7 (44.3) Profit for the period amounted to MSEK 9.2 (36.0). Earnings per share amounted to SEK 0.81 (3.16).Period January – JuneOrder bookings decreased by 26 percent to MSEK 390 (525). Net revenue expressed in SEK decreased by 12 percent to MSEK 451 (511). Net revenue adjusted for currency effects amounted to MSEK 430, i.e. an underlying organic decrease of 16 percent. Operating profit amounted to MSEK 33.0 (85.1).
